免费LLM API密钥一网打尽,AI项目开发不再愁!
- 免费干货
- 17小时前
- 28热度
- 0评论
在当今快速发展的AI时代,大型语言模型(LLM)已成为无数创新应用的核心。然而,访问高质量的LLM API往往伴随着高昂的成本和复杂的申请流程。
别担心! 本文将为你揭秘如何免费获取来自NVIDIA、Grok、GitHub、Google AI Studio、OpenRouter和Cloudflare等顶级平台的LLM API密钥,让你轻松启动AI项目,尽享技术红利!
🌟 核心主题:免费获取多平台LLM API密钥
本视频的核心目标是向开发者展示如何从多个领先的AI服务提供商处获取免费的API密钥或访问令牌,以便在个人或小型项目中无成本地使用各种LLM模型。这包括生成式AI模型、推理微服务等,覆盖了文本、图像、语音等多种模态,旨在降低AI开发的门槛,加速创新。
💻 代码与实现
以下是一些平台生成API密钥后,用于调用API的Python示例代码片段。请注意,YOUR_API_KEY 或 YOUR_PERSONAL_ACCESS_TOKEN 需要替换为实际生成的密钥或令牌。
NVIDIA NIM 示例 (Python)
fromopenaiimportOpenAI
importjson
client = OpenAI(
base_url="https://integrate.api.nvidia.com/v1",
api_key="YOUR_API_KEY"# 替换为你的API Key
)
completion = client.chat.completions.create(
model="meta/llama-4-maverick-17b-128e-instruct", # 替换为实际模型
messages=[{"role": "user", "content": ""}],
temperature=1,
top_p=0.9,
max_tokens=1024,
stream=True
)
forchunkincompletion:
ifnothasattr(chunk.choices[0].delta, "content"):
continue
print(chunk.choices[0].delta.contentor"", end="")
Groq 示例 (Python)
fromgroqimportGroq
client = Groq(
api_key="YOUR_API_KEY"# 替换为你的API Key
)
chat_completion = client.chat.completions.create(
messages=[
{
"role": "user",
"content": "Explain the importance of low-latency LLMs",
}
],
model="mixtral-8x7b-32768", # 替换为实际模型
)
print(chat_completion.choices[0].message.content)
Cloudflare Workers AI 示例 (Python)
importos
importrequests
# 确保你的环境变量中设置了CLOUDFLARE_API_KEY和CLOUDFLARE_ACCOUNT_ID
# 或者在此处直接替换
CLOUDFLARE_API_KEY = os.environ.get("CLOUDFLARE_API_KEY")
CLOUDFLARE_ACCOUNT_ID = os.environ.get("CLOUDFLARE_ACCOUNT_ID")
ifnotCLOUDFLARE_API_KEYornotCLOUDFLARE_ACCOUNT_ID:
raiseValueError("请设置CLOUDFLARE_API_KEY和CLOUDFLARE_ACCOUNT_ID环境变量")
headers = {
"Authorization": f"Bearer {CLOUDFLARE_API_KEY}",
"Content-Type": "application/json",
}
# 示例:使用 gpt-oss-120b 模型
model_id = "@cf/openai/gpt-oss-120b"
api_url = f"https://api.cloudflare.com/client/v4/accounts/{CLOUDFLARE_ACCOUNT_ID}/ai/run/{model_id}"
data = {
"prompt": "What are the benefits of open-source models?"
}
response = requests.post(api_url, headers=headers, json=data)
response.raise_for_status() # 检查请求是否成功
print(response.json())
📝 免费API密钥获取与操作步骤
我将逐一介绍如何在这些平台上获取API密钥,助你快速上手!
1. NVIDIA NIM:解锁强大模型推理能力
- 访问平台: build.nvidia.com
- 生成API Key: 在主页右侧找到“API Keys”区域,点击“Get API Key”按钮生成API密钥。
- 管理API Key: 点击“Manage API Keys”查看和删除已生成的密钥。
2. Groq:体验极速推理
- 访问平台: console.groq.com/keys
- 生成API Key: 点击“Create API Key”按钮生成API密钥。
3. GitHub Models:探索社区AI生态
- 访问平台: github.com/marketplace?type=models
- 获取个人访问令牌 (PAT): 在GitHub上创建并配置个人访问令牌。
4. Google AI Studio:玩转Gemini等谷歌模型
- 访问平台: aistudio.google.com/app/apikey
- 生成API Key: 选择“Get API key”并创建密钥。
5. OpenRouter:聚合LLM的便捷入口
- 访问平台: openrouter.ai
- 生成API Key: 点击“Create API Key”并保存密钥。
6. Cloudflare Workers AI:利用边缘AI服务
- 访问平台: developers.cloudflare.com/workers-ai/models/
- 获取代码片段: 在模型详情页找到并复制代码片段。
7. 终极资源库:GitHub Free LLM API Resources
🎯 拥抱免费AI,开启无限可能!
如你所见,现在有大量免费的AI模型API和资源可供我们利用。从NVIDIA的推理微服务到Groq的极速模型,再到GitHub上的多样化选择、Google AI Studio的Gemini家族、OpenRouter的聚合优势以及Cloudflare Workers AI的边缘计算能力,我们拥有前所未有的机会来构建和实验各种AI应用。
无论你是初入AI领域的学生,还是经验丰富的开发者,这些免费资源都能为你提供强大的支持,让你无需担心成本,专注于创新。立即行动,获取你的API密钥,让你的AI项目从设想变为现实吧!
转自:https://mp.weixin.qq.com/s/JhvR6hpnXFZee6AHM3soSg